Former UNC defensive back Gerald Sensabaugh looks back on NFL, college careers
Posted Feb 11, 2022
Former UNC defensive back Gerald Sensabaugh played eight seasons in the NFL, the first four for the Jacksonville Jaguars and the last with the Dallas Cowboys. Sensabaugh reflected on a variety of topics ranging from his NFL days, to college at East Tennessee State and North Carolina. "(UNC's) campus was amazing. I really loved going to that school."
